Emirates Stadium to host Brazil v Chile

Brazil v Chile

Arsenal Football Club is delighted to announce that Emirates Stadium will host an international friendly between Brazil and Chile on Sunday, March 29.

The match will kick off at 3pm and the club is pleased to announce that Arsenal members will receive the exclusive first rights on purchasing tickets for this high-profile fixture, with prices starting from £15 for concessions and £30 for adults*. The South American clash promises to be an exciting encounter, with emerging force Chile going up against Brazil, the most successful team in World Cup history with five titles.

The clash at Emirates Stadium will be the first time that the teams have met since the 2014 World Cup in Brazil, when the hosts won a dramatic encounter 3-2 on penalties, after finishing 1-1 after extra time. The match in London will provide both teams with good preparation ahead of this summer’s Copa America in Chile, in what could be a dress-rehearsal for the final.

Arguably two of the most talented players in the world will come face-to-face with other in this mouth-watering clash, with Brazil and Barcelona star Neymar facing Arsenal star Alexis Sanchez.

Furthermore, the Brazil team also currently features the likes of Philippe Coutinho, Willian, Oscar and David Luiz, while Chile have stars such as Arturo Vidal, Mauricio Isla, Gary Medel and Eduardo Vargas.

This will be the seventh time that the Brazil team has played at Emirates Stadium. This match follows the successful staging of Brazil v Scotland in March 2011, Brazil v Republic of Ireland in March 2010, Brazil v Italy in February 2009, Brazil v Sweden in March 2008, Brazil v Portugal in February 2007 and Brazil v Argentina shortly after the opening of Emirates Stadium in September 2006.

Arsenal chief executive officer Ivan Gazidis said: “Everyone at Arsenal Football Club is proud to once again be hosting a high-profile international match at Emirates Stadium. The national teams of Brazil and Chile have many fantastic players and the match will give football fans the opportunity to watch an international friendly of the highest calibre.

“It’s a compliment to both Arsenal Football Club and Emirates Stadium that we will once again be hosting a fixture of this magnitude. We are all looking forward to what is sure to be a fantastic occasion.”
